Overview
Under general direction of the VP of Finance, the Payroll Manager ensures the efficient and effective operations of the organization's payroll function for the UBS Arena location which includes exempt, non-exempt, and union employees.
Compliance with all regulatory agencies and adherence to OVG's accounting and Human Resources policies is critical. The Payroll Manager will provide support and maintain a high level of customer service to all employees of the company.

Responsibilities
Ensure accurate processing and recording of all company payroll including union and non union payrolls
Manage and oversee all payroll processing activities, including calculating and processing employee wages, salaries, bonuses, and deductions
Work closely with union representatives to ensure accurate and timely processing of union -related payroll activities
Resolves employee concerns in a timely manner by thoroughly researching and investigating the issue(s) and reporting back the findings to the employee or escalating to the VP Finance for resolution
Create and audit reports required by local Collective Bargaining Agreements
Monitor changes and remains current on legal, regulatory, or governmental requirements (e.g., wage and hour, garnishments, tax matters, 401K and other benefit deductions)
Validates and prepares off-cycle manual check requests to ensure that all employees receive any additional funds owed
Assist with uploading of files for new hires and employee changes using ADP EV5 Payroll Systems
Process employee direct deposits and tax withholding changes
Maintains the accuracy and integrity of the payroll system by carefully reviewing all entries made and remaining aware of their impact on the payroll process
Maintains confidentiality regarding associates' personal information and payroll data at all times
Assist in evaluation of ADP EV5 Payroll System to determine changes necessary for better process flow
Update individual payrolls as stipulated by management, such a tax deductions or salary adjustments
Will oversee, supervise, and determine changes necessary for optimal process flow
Maintaining payroll systems implementing best practices to improve processes and enhance efficiency and accuracy
Ensuring all payroll systems comply with federal tax laws and legal requirements
Create state and federal withholding accounts on behalf of the company, as necessary, to ensure proper quarterly/ annual filings
Generate payroll reports for management and finance departments
Build partnerships and solicit feedback from internal and external business partners to define and develop successful scalable processes and practices for the company
Oversee the preparation of required reports or payments to government agencies, insurance companies, or other organizations
Act as a payroll liaison between Corporate Payroll and UBS Arena
Qualifications
Three to five years' experience in a payroll position with increasing level of oversight and responsibility
Thorough understanding of accounting and financial reporting principles and practices
Demonstrate knowledge of payroll and tax issues, basic knowledge of employment law
Experience with collective bargaining units, or union payroll
Advanced proficiency with computers in a Windows platform including Microsoft applications, accounting/payroll/HRIS systems and ADP Enterprise
Extensive experience preparing accurate spreadsheets and reports
Consistent and reliable attention to detail, accuracy and validity
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ced, changing environment
Must work well under pressure of deadlines
Ability to successfully interact and collaborate all team members professionally and supportively
Excellent organizational and time management skills; ability to delegate tasks as required
